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Interior HH Lt. General Shaikh Saif bin Zayed Al Nahyan, attended yesterday the signing of electronic link agreement between the ministries of Interior and Labour in presence of the Labour Minister HE Saqr Ghobash.

The event was also attended by Major General Nasser Lakhraibani Al Nuaimi, Secretary General of the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Interior’s office and a number of senior officials from both ministries.

Major General Nasser bin Al Awadhi Al Minhali, Acting assistant Undersecretary for Naturalisation, Residency and Ports affairs at the Ministry of Interior, signed on behalf of the Interior ministry, while Humaid Rashid bin Dimas Al Suwaidi, Director General of the Labour Ministry signed on behalf of the Labour ministry.

Commenting on the agreement, Al Minhali said that the agreement calls joint cooperation among the federal ministries in line with the UAE government strategy. As per the agreement, measures have been set up to streamline administrative, technical and electronic link between the two ministries in convenient and safe environment, whereby the both ministries will swap information efficiently and effectively.

He added that the project will help get rid of paper files to be replaced by the e-government procedures to ensure data accuracy, save time and energy, adding that the move will also curb forgery of labour permits.

‘The agreement will help provide necessary data for both ministries, such as entry and employment visas, the dates of entry, dates of residence visa cancellation and residence visa data, including number of residence visa, date of issuance, date of expiry, dates of renewal, labour absconding reports and others’, Al Minhali said.

He hailed the joint cooperation and coordination between the two ministries to further enhance the services rendered to the public.

On his part, Dimas said that the deal ‘is historic and important for the both ministries at a time the UAE is witnessing comprehensive national developments under leadership of Vice President and Prime Minister of UAE and Ruler of Dubai His Highness Shaikh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, who urged for integration among the public institutions to work as one team.
